A picture frame has a total perimeter of 2 meters. The height of the frame is 0.62 times its width.
(a) Write the height in terms of the width and write an equation for the perimeter in terms of the width.
I know that the height would be h=0.62w
but I don't know how to set up the perimeter. I think it goes something like p=_w. So, could you help out with figuring out what goes there in the blank.

to go around the frame, which is what the perimeter is, you will need two widths and two heights.
so..
2w + 2h = 2
or
w + h = 1 by dividing by 2
but h = .62w
so w + .62 w = 1
1.62w = 1
solve for w
